The miniature Australian Shepherd dog came about as a result of breeding smaller Australian Shepherd dogs for the desired size. Their popularity is rising fast among individuals who prefer small dogs that exhibit a very strong work ethic. They are well known for dog agility, but they are also good at various dog sports such as flyball, disc dog, obedience, and herding. This information is good for people who are thinking about acquiring Mini Aussie puppies. The coat of the species is moderate in height and has different colorations. There are 16 possible coat color combinations in existence. Among the possible combinations include self blue merle, black bicolor, black tricolor, red merle and tan, self red merle, and red merle and white.

The multi-colored coat comes in different patterns including straight and wavy. The backs of the legs have featherings while the necks have a mane and frill surrounding them. Compared to other parts of the body, which have the same size of the coat, hair outside the ears, on the head, and front side of the legs is shorter. The species is well balanced with the length of front legs and hindquarters being equal. Feet are compact and oval-shaped.

There is a wide range of colors for the eyes. Most commonly observed eye colors include amber, blue, marbled, brown, and hazel. The colors named may appear singly or in combination. It is also common to see some dogs with the eyes colored differently. Bobtails exist naturally in some dogs while others need to have their long tails docked.

Mini Aussies are highly trainable. However, their high level of drive and intelligence makes it necessary for them to be given prior obedience training and interesting activities in plenty. Their desire for approval also makes them easy to train. They can live and survive anywhere with the right training. They must be provided by means of letting out excess mental and physical energy.

Failure to give these dogs enough exercise or stimuli may cause them to become destructive. The dogs have a strong herding background and instincts. Thus, in the absence of cattle to herd, they tend to herd people, especially small children, often nipping at the heels when they stray. Early training and intervention can help to overcome this instinct.

Mini Aussies are highly social dogs and they form very strong and close attachments to their owners. This has led them to suffer from separation anxiety when they are separated from their owners. They form good family dogs too. However, because of their excessive energy adult supervision may be necessary whenever the dogs are left alone with small children.

All varieties of Australian Shepherds seem to be affected by eye defects of varying degrees of severity. The blind/deaf factor is also encompassed in the gene for merle coloration. Before carrying the puppy home, one should have a veterinarian check the hips, eyes, and ears. It is also important to check parentage too.
